Christchurch (CHC) to Robinhood Airport (ROH)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Christchurch International Airport (CHC) in Christchurch, New Zealand to Robinhood Airport (ROH) in Robinhood Airport, Australia is 3,840 kilometers (2,386 miles / 2,073 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 6h, flying northwest at a heading of 306°.

This is a medium-haul route that may be operated by either narrow-body or wide-body aircraft depending on demand. Passengers can expect a meal service on most carriers.

This is an international route connecting New Zealand with Australia.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 09:45 in Christchurch, it's 06:45 in Robinhood Airport. The 3-hour time difference may cause some jet lag. Most travelers adjust within a day or two.

The return flight from Robinhood Airport (ROH) to Christchurch (CHC) follows a heading of 142° (southeast).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
